Output 202fe9b0a39868eb2ee8d3ca6be59be53bb2eeec8df633ea46e26a4c8b027e15:11

value
29990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00151469729a5f686889624700990d672c728151 OP_EQUAL
address
31hTBBwDzFwH7fdAi5h3oVSExFV1ZMLx2D
transaction
202fe9b0a39868eb2ee8d3ca6be59be53bb2eeec8df633ea46e26a4c8b027e15
confirmations
34281
spent
true